Why is kheer left under the moon on Sharad Purnima?
The Ashvin full moon is held to rise with all sixteen kalas and its light to carry amrita. Kheer left open in that light overnight is believed to absorb it and become a healing prasad eaten at dawn.
What does Kojagari mean?
It is from 'ko jagarti' — 'who is awake?' Lakshmi is believed to move through the world that night asking this, blessing those she finds keeping vigil. Staying awake in worship is the heart of the vow.
Is Sharad Purnima connected to Krishna?
Yes — in the Braj tradition it is the night of the maha-raas, when Krishna danced with the gopis under the autumn moon. It is celebrated with raas songs alongside the moon and Lakshmi worship.
